The Department of Veterans Affairs, American Lake VA Medical Center requires Garage Door Maintenance, Repair and Replacement services in accordance with the statement of work. See salient characteristics for brand name or equal to specifications. This is notice of a total SB set-aside. Offerors must be registered as a certified SB in the SBA DSBS database at time of offer and award to be considered eligible. See section E.8 for submission requirements and 52.225 Buy American Certification.
Questions for this RFQ will be accepted by email only at adam.hill3@va.gov on or before 12/29/2025. It is highly recommended that all interested Vendors attend a site visit on 12/12/2025 10:00 PST at American Lake VAMC Bldg 18 Lobby. RSVP Adam Hill adam.hill3@va.gov by 12/11/2025.
Amendment 0001 On Bldg 21 – We are unable to get a door that is 8x9’2” due to the headroom available. R&S Manufacturing makes their headplates 16” making the door we could get 8x9’8”. This will make it stick in the opening 6”. Eligible offerors and quotes conforming to the submission requirements will be evaluated based on the salient characteristics and technical specifications submitted of all equipment quoted. Please see new attachments; Attachment A – Door Specifications and Attachment B - Door Photos.
Building 20 – Three doors have motors with no safety devices. We would need to install new motor with safety devices. Or make the doors manual and install slide locks on the inside. The requirement does not include motor replacement for the doors where maintenance and repairs are being conducted (QTY4EA Doors). The contractor shall perform maintenance and minor repairs only, including rollers, hinges, springs, lubrication, and calibration. Existing VA owned motors are to remain in place and are not to be replaced.
The two doors needing replaced have Safe Edges, but the new motors will come with photo-eyes. Do you still want safe edges? The salient characteristics require UL 325 compliant entrapment protection using monitored photo eyes or edge sensors. Any Edge sensors quoted must meet compliance with UL 325. On the new doors, will bake on gray primer be okay. Or do you want powder coated and if so what color? The required finish is baked-on grey polyester primer as stated in the salient characteristics. Powder coating is not required.
